Subject: StockTally reconciliation job — schedule change

Plugin authors: the nightly inventory reconciliation job now runs at 01:30 instead of 03:00. If your plugin writes stock adjustments, flush them before that window or they'll land in the next cycle. No API changes. Pin your integration tests to the build referenced by the token below.

pipeline stamp: htk31_f769b577b3028a4e9958e5bb8d1259a

## Local Setup

Feedlint validates podcast RSS feeds against our extended ruleset, and plugin authors should run it locally before submitting. After installing dependencies with `make deps`, seed the fixture feeds with `make seed`. The validator stores rule results in a small local database; point your environment at it using the connection string below.

primary connection of tajeg-tajop = postgresql://julax_svc:DI@db-e7f3.kelvidyn.corp:5432/rusdor

## Handling Rounding Discrepancies

Plugins converting amounts through the Quillpay gateway must round only at the final display step, never per line item. Intermediate values keep four decimal places; the settlement engine reconciles to two. If your plugin's totals differ from Quillpay's by more than one minor unit, you are rounding early. The canonical rounding rules are documented internally here:

operations page: https://confluence.tolvaqsys.corp/spaces/pages/pages/6e787158f507

### Runbook: Report export timezone mismatches (Glimmerfield)

If a customer reports that exported totals differ from the dashboard, check whether their report schedule predates the March cutover — older schedules still render in server-local time rather than the account timezone. Re-saving the schedule fixes it. Before escalating, confirm the export worker is running with the expected timezone settings shown below.

config for kadup-kajog:
[raldor]
host = raldor.tolvaqworks.internal
user = raldor_svc
database = raldor_prod